GE Vivid 7 4D Ultrasound — Overview
The GE Vivid 7 4D holds a significant place in the history of echocardiography — as one of GE Healthcare’s most successful and widely deployed cardiovascular platforms, it was instrumental in establishing real-time 3D echocardiography as a clinical standard in cardiac imaging labs worldwide. The Vivid 7 4D combines the solid 2D echocardiographic performance of the Vivid 7 platform with real-time 3D acquisition capability, providing cardiologists with the volumetric data needed for cardiac chamber quantification, valve assessment, and structural heart evaluation.
Key Features
- Real-Time 3D/4D Echocardiography — live 3D cardiac volume acquisition for structural heart assessment
- Tissue Doppler Imaging (TDI) — myocardial velocity measurements and diastolic function protocols
- Color, CW & PW Doppler — comprehensive cardiac flow and gradient measurement
- Advanced 2D Cardiac Imaging — high-resolution phased array echocardiography
- Stress Echo — integrated wall motion analysis workflow
- Vascular Imaging — linear probe compatibility for carotid and peripheral vascular studies
- EchoPAC™ Compatibility — data export to GE’s advanced cardiac analysis platform
Technical Specifications
| Specification | Detail |
|---|---|
| System Type | Cart-based cardiovascular ultrasound (classic generation) |
| Primary Applications | Echocardiography, 3D Cardiac, Stress Echo, Vascular, Abdominal |
| Imaging Modes | 2D, M-Mode, 3D/4D Real-Time, Color/CW/PW Doppler, TDI, Tissue Tracking |
